Cost Structure and Return on Investment: A Detailed Financial Analysis
For veterinary clinics pursuing excellence and efficiency, the initial investment in a digital dental imaging system typically ranges around $15,000. While this represents a substantial upfront cost, a broader strategic perspective reveals surprisingly attractive returns.
1. Cost Breakdown
-
Hardware (70-80% of total investment):
Includes digital X-ray generators, digital detectors (DR sensors), workstations, and necessary accessories. Advanced CMOS technology sensors command higher prices but deliver superior image quality and durability.
-
Software (10-15%):
Encompasses dental imaging processing software, image management systems (PACS), and potential integration with practice management systems.
-
Installation and Training (5-10%):
Professional installation ensures proper operation, while comprehensive training maximizes system utilization.
2. ROI Analysis
The $15,000 investment typically achieves breakeven within 3-6 months through multiple revenue streams:
Direct Revenue Increases:
-
Elimination of film and chemical costs
-
Time savings from immediate imaging (potentially 2.5 hours daily in busy practices)
-
Opportunity for premium pricing of dental services
Indirect Benefits:
-
Earlier detection of dental pathologies (potentially 50 additional cases annually at $300 each)
-
Enhanced client trust through visual documentation
-
Reduced misdiagnosis risks and associated liabilities
Technological Advancements Driving Innovation
Recent developments in digital X-ray detectors and generators have fundamentally improved imaging quality and workflow efficiency.
1. X-ray Generator Technology
-
Solid-State Timing Systems:
Provide millisecond-level precision in exposure control, reducing image quality variations.
-
Carbon Nanotube (CNT) Technology:
Eliminates warm-up periods, reduces equipment weight, and improves image stability.
2. Digital X-ray Detector Technology
Modern CMOS sensors offer:
-
Superior resolution (2.5 lp/mm or higher)
-
Consistent image quality across examinations
-
Enhanced durability compared to film systems
Operational Advantages and Clinical Applications
Digital systems provide comprehensive benefits across multiple practice areas:
1. Workflow Optimization
-
Immediate image availability (versus 10-20 minute film processing)
-
Elimination of chemical processing and associated environmental concerns
-
Reduced retake rates through real-time image verification
2. Advanced Image Management
-
Systematic electronic storage with easy retrieval
-
Comparative analysis with historical images
-
Sophisticated measurement and enhancement tools
3. Client Communication
-
Visual demonstration of dental conditions enhances understanding
-
Increases treatment plan acceptance rates
-
Generates positive "wow" factor that builds practice reputation
